/* * PackageLicenseDeclared: Apache-2.0 * Copyright (c) 2016 ARM Limited * * Licensed under the Apache License, Version 2.0 (the "License"); * you may not use this file except in compliance with the License. * You may obtain a copy of the License at * * http://www.apache.org/licenses/LICENSE-2.0 * * Unless required by applicable law or agreed to in writing, software * distributed under the License is distributed on an "AS IS" BASIS, * WITHOUT WARRANTIES OR CONDITIONS OF ANY KIND, either express or implied. * See the License for the specific language governing permissions and * limitations under the License. */ #ifndef _ARM_GATT_SERVER_H_ #define _ARM_GATT_SERVER_H_ #include <stddef.h> #include "blecommon.h" #include "GattServer.h" #include "generic/wsf_types.h" #include "att_api.h" class ArmGattServer : public GattServer { public: static ArmGattServer &getInstance(); /* Functions that must be implemented from GattServer */ virtual ble_error_t addService(GattService &); virtual ble_error_t read(GattAttribute::Handle_t attributeHandle, uint8_t buffer[], uint16_t *lengthP); virtual ble_error_t read(Gap::Handle_t connectionHandle, GattAttribute::Handle_t attributeHandle, uint8_t buffer[], uint16_t *lengthP); virtual ble_error_t write(GattAttribute::Handle_t, const uint8_t[], uint16_t, bool localOnly = false); virtual ble_error_t write(Gap::Handle_t connectionHandle, GattAttribute::Handle_t, const uint8_t[], uint16_t, bool localOnly = false); virtual ble_error_t areUpdatesEnabled(const GattCharacteristic &characteristic, bool *enabledP); virtual ble_error_t areUpdatesEnabled(Gap::Handle_t connectionHandle, const GattCharacteristic &characteristic, bool *enabledP); virtual bool isOnDataReadAvailable() const { return true; } private: static void cccCback(attsCccEvt_t *pEvt); static void attCback(attEvt_t *pEvt); static uint8_t attsReadCback(dmConnId_t connId, uint16_t handle, uint8_t operation, uint16_t offset, attsAttr_t *pAttr); static uint8_t attsWriteCback(dmConnId_t connId, uint16_t handle, uint8_t operation, uint16_t offset, uint16_t len, uint8_t *pValue, attsAttr_t *pAttr); /*! client characteristic configuration descriptors settings */ #define MAX_CCC_CNT 20 attsCccSet_t cccSet[MAX_CCC_CNT]; uint16_t cccValues[MAX_CCC_CNT]; uint16_t cccHandles[MAX_CCC_CNT]; uint8_t cccCnt; private: ArmGattServer() : GattServer(), cccSet(), cccValues(), cccHandles(), cccCnt(0) { /* empty */ } ArmGattServer(const ArmGattServer &); const ArmGattServer& operator=(const ArmGattServer &); }; #endif /* _ARM_GATT_SERVER_H_ */
